Enter into a spacious hallway with beautiful wooden floors and gorgeous staircase leading to the first floor, tinkle the ivories of the piano positioned in this bright and inviting space. Off the hallway to the left is the impressive large dining room table that seats 12 people, perfect for a family get together. Off to the right of the entrance hall is the cosy lounge to enjoy a good book in front of the open fire, a board game with friends or family or simply unwind after a busy day and watch a film on the TV/DVD. At the end of the hallway you will find the kitchen with an AGA , electric oven and hob, dishwasher, fridge/freezer, larder fridge, microwave, and Sheila Maid ceiling clothes airer, breakfast bar and a door leading to the inner hallway with Yorkshire Stone flagged floor, separate WC, coat hooks, boot rack, and a lovely ground floor double bedroom. A door leads to the side entrance to the outside of the property. Further off the inner hallway is the galleried garden room with door which lead out to the garden where you can plan where to explore the following day. Off the garden room, a door which leads to the utility room with washer/dryer and a door leading out to the parking space and garden. Heading upstairs you will find four double bedrooms, two with an en suite shower and WC, and one twin bedroom. On this floor, you will find the bathroom with roll top bath, separate shower and WC. Also on this floor you will find the galleried office space with two steps down, a child s safety gate is in place to this area. Heading outside you will find an off road parking space for two or three cars with roadside parking nearby for additional cars. Enjoy the stunning garden, pick the fruit from the trees if you are lucky enough to visit at the right time. The garden is predominantly grassed and has a patio with table and chairs, a further table and seating area is available to enjoy outside dining with a charcoal BBQ. Please note, the garden quite large and not fully enclosed so dogs and children would need to be supervised at all times.
